Material: Polypropylene
- Chemical Resistance: Polypropylene is resistant to many chemicals, making it suitable for various industrial applications.
- Durability: It is a durable plastic that can withstand harsh environments.
Function: Breather Valve
- Pressure Regulation: Breather valves maintain the internal pressure of a tank or vessel within a safe range. They allow air to enter or exit the container to balance pressure differences.
- Protection: By regulating pressure, they protect the container from rupturing or imploding due to pressure changes.
Applications
- Storage Tanks: Used in storage tanks for liquids and gases to prevent overpressure or vacuum conditions.
- Chemical Processing: Common in chemical processing plants where polypropylene's chemical resistance is beneficial.
- Water Treatment: Used in water treatment facilities to maintain pressure in tanks and prevent contamination.
Benefits
- Corrosion Resistance: Polypropylene is resistant to corrosion, which extends the lifespan of the valve.
- Lightweight: Easier to install and handle compared to metal valves.
- Cost-Effective: Generally less expensive than metal alternatives.
Maintenance
- Inspection: Regular inspection is necessary to ensure the valve is functioning correctly.
- Cleaning: Polypropylene valves are relatively easy to clean and maintain due to their smooth surface.

Q: How does the automatic operation of the Polypropylene Breather Valve work?
A: The valve uses a spring-loaded, diaphragm mechanism that opens or closes in response to pressure changes, automatically releasing excess pressure or vacuum within set limits (10 mbar to 700 mbar) to protect tanks and systems without requiring manual or electric activation.
